1370: *【中级组】数字围墙

Memory Limit:128 MB Time Limit:1.000 S
Judge Style:Text Compare Creator:
Submit:63 Solved:28

Description

        现有1~n的数字对,请你将这2n个数字排列成一行,要求在数字1之间围一个数,数字2之间围两个数,数字3之间围三个数…。既数字n间围n个数字。要求输出 n能围成数字围墙的方案共有多少种。        例如:n=3时,  312132 是一种答案。如下扑克牌图示:


    
   示例

       输出:  n = 3        输出:2
       解释: 共有两种方案:  2 3 1 2 1 3  与  3 1 2 1 3 2 。
 
      

Input

           输入一个数字为n 。

Output

       输出只一个数字为 n能围成数字围墙的方案共有多少种。若没有可行的方案输出为零。

Sample Input Copy

3

Sample Output Copy

2

HINT

提示:

3<= n <=10